Trinity Solar
25 mile radius of Waltham, MA
7/3/2024
Norwood, MA, US
Burlington, MA, US
Lynn, MA, US
Waltham, MA, US
Medford, MA, US
Saugus, MA, US
Nashua, NH, US
Stoughton, MA, US
Andover, MA, US
Needham, MA, US